I have two offers both in EU.

Context: I have a bachelor in business and master in ds. I just graduated and I am trying to figure out what to do with my life. In the future I would like to try to switch to ds / swe and give it a try but I am not 100% certain about this choice yet. I plan to work in large companies especially FANG in the future.

Amazon offer, business analyst. Not enjoy the work, is mainly dashboards and KPI.
Advantages: Maybe I can change to better opportunities after 1 year. Show that I worked in a big company so more interest by other big tech. Is in London, so better for networking.
Disadvantages: The idea to do this work for 1 year really bothers me because it is really frustrating. It is only metrics with low possibility to innovate. Furthermore, other FANG will be interested for other business roles, not ds roles.

Startup: quantitative finance, better in term of quality of work, not a lot of ML but they are planning to do that in the future. I am concerned because is only 9 employees. I talked with an ex employee and she told me that you learn a lot about quant finance and you code as well.
Advantages: I think this opportunity is more related to ds and will help me to understand if a tech job is right for me or not.
Disadvantages: very small, difficult to show you did solid work in a small environment and land big companies in the future.

I would like to accept startup but worried to be blacklisted by Amazon ( accepted offer but not signed contract) and not able to land a FANG offer in the near future (2-3 years).

    To my knowledge DS jobs in FANGs turns out to be BA kind of role involving SQL, KPI tracking, creating dashboards etc. The roles that require building ML models usually are offered to candidates with PHDs. There are some exceptions of course.

    Joining as BA and later trying to switch to SDE is a good idea. I feel like DS roles usually don’t have a lot of satisfaction rate in general. Mainly due to their idea of DS is different from the work they do at job. SDE roles have a clear milestones to reach in terms of career development. And the skills you learn as SDE could later be made use in combination with DS knowledge in roles like ML engineer.
